JONATHAN HARWELL is a founding member of H3GM and currently is Of Counsel in the firm's Real Estate and Corporate practice groups.

Jonny is a career-long member of the Nashville, Tennessee and American Bar Associations. As a member of the Nashville Bar Association, he has served the Nashville legal community in a variety of capacities including the following: from 1977 to 1979 he served as chair of the NBA's Grievance Committee; from 1981-1982 he served as chair of the NBA's Judicial Endorsement Committee; from 1983-1984 he served as chair of the NBA's Chancery, Circuit and Probate Court Committee; from 1985-1986 he served as chair of the NBA's CLE Committee; and, from 1986 to 1989 he served as a member of the NBA's board of directors. Jonny was elected president of the Nashville Bar Association in 1989, and from 1989-1990 he was a member of American Bar Association's Board of Elections. He has also served as a member of the Vanderbilt School of Law Alumni Board and Leadership Nashville. Jonny received his B.A. and LL.B from Vanderbilt University.
